After almost 2 years of trying to get to the place, I finally made it! It was so worth the wait. I had a wonderful experience! Very personable staff, beautiful location, great food and amazing ice cream.
They have ADULT ice cream (alcohol infused) and regular ice cream. You can't go wrong with either (award winners for several flavors). All ice cream is made in house. Because of the multitude of flavors, we did ice cream flights of four different flavors a piece. Also, got to sample a few other flavors as well. The caramel flan, rum raisin, butter beer and Kentucky Bourbon with salted caramel were my favorites. The rum raisin reminded me of the rum raisin I tasted in Europe. Apparently, they get that compliment a lot. Very robust, flavorful and creamy.

Servers were nice. Food was fine. Extremely long wait after an order was entered incorrectly. 10% discount was given and appreciated. My concern was an accessibility issue. From ramp at handicapped parking, outside tables and chairs blocked sidewalk and kept us from using wheelchair for our son. He was able to slowly walk inside but seating was an issue for someone with limited mobility. One communal table with traditional chairs was already full. High top tables and bar type seats didn't offer much support and made navigating a challenge. Cozy booths had old church pews with high sides that made sitting difficult. Ice cream was delicious, but they were sold out of several choices by 3:00pm on a Sunday. Popular spot with a very casual atmosphere. Our first visit was disappointing.
